Chandigarh, August 6

Advertisement

Vedant Garg scored 6.5 points to bag the top position in the 34th Chandigarh Chess Championship, which concluded at Dr Ambedkar Bhawan, Sector 37, here. Along with Garg, Pratyaksh Goel (6 points), Abhinandan Vohra (6 points) and Sanjeev Biswas (5.5 points), who were among the top four, have been selected for the 61st National Chess Championship to be held in Gurgaon from August 17 to 27. The championship was organised by the Chandigarh Chess Association and a total of 78 players participated in it.

Ekaaksha Partap Singh Negi, Sidharth Bhargav, Amogh Agrawal, Ayaan Garg, Swastik Singhal, Atharv Singh Negi, Akshun Punchhi and Dishant Bansal scored five points each. — TNS
